Naturally, Anderson moved up. He became a correspondent for ABC News and a co-anchor for World News Now. He switched things up by hosting reality show The Mole, but after 9/11 he decided to get back into news. In 2001, he co-hosted American Morning with Paula Zahn and in 2002 became CNNs weekend prime-time anchor. Finally in 2003 he got his own show, Anderson Cooper 360.

He has covered such stories as the wars in Afghanistan and Iraq and natural disasters like the tsunami in Indonesia, hurricane Katrina, the earthquake in Haiti, the Gulf oil spill and the crisis in Japan.
